Begin your journey with Salem’s 400-Year Tale as the clock strikes 1 PM. This award-winning historical walking tour, led by the charismatic Jobian Day, takes you through the heart of Salem’s downtown. As you wander through the rain-soaked streets, you’ll uncover the layers of history that have shaped this city, from the infamous witch trials of 1692 to its role in contemporary American history. The tour is a tapestry of tales, woven with the threads of colonial conflict and modern-day intrigue.

The Salem Witch Trials Memorial stands as a solemn tribute to those who suffered during this dark chapter. Here, the rain seems to echo the tears of the past, a poignant reminder of the human cost of fear and superstition. As you explore the memorial, the stories of the accused and the accusers come alive, painting a vivid picture of a community torn apart by hysteria.

At 6 PM on March 30th, join the Haunting Historical Tour for an immersive experience that delves into the heart of Salem’s witch trials.

Led by passionate storytellers, this tour takes you to significant landmarks such as the Essex Museum, The Witch House, and the symbolic Witch Trials Memorial. The Witch House, with its dark, gabled roof and centuries-old timbers, stands as the only surviving structure with direct ties to the trials. Here, the past whispers through the walls, recounting the tales of Judge Jonathan Corwin and the innocents he condemned.

Hidden Corners and Forgotten Tales

Beyond the well-trodden paths of Salem’s witch trials, the city offers a wealth of hidden gems waiting to be discovered. The rain-soaked streets and overcast skies create the perfect backdrop for exploring these lesser-known corners, where history and mystery intertwine.

Venture into the Howard Street Cemetery, where the old witch jail once stood. Here, the tale of Giles Cory, who was pressed to death for refusing to plead, lingers in the air. The cemetery, with its weathered tombstones and ancient trees, is a place where the past feels palpably present, a testament to the enduring power of Salem’s stories.
